as shown in the diagram, when environmental temperatures drop below freezing, a layer of ice typically forms on the surface of bodies of freshwater such as lakes and rivers. which of the following best describes how the structure of ice benefits the organisms that live in the water below? a the water molecules in ice are closer together than those in liquid water, so the ice prevents the passage of air to the water, maintaining a constant gas mixture in the water. b the water molecules in ice are closer together than those in liquid water, so the ice forms a barrier that protects the organisms in the water from the freezing air temperatures. c the water molecules in ice are farther apart than those in liquid water, so the ice floats, maintaining the warmer, denser water at the lake bottom. d the water molecules in ice are farther apart than those in liquid water, so the ice floats, preventing the escape of gases from the liquid water.

Explanation:

Brief Explanations

Water molecules in ice are more spread - out (less dense) than in liquid water due to hydrogen - bonding patterns. This causes ice to float. The floating ice insulates the water below, maintaining warmer and denser water at the bottom of the lake or river, which is beneficial for aquatic organisms.

Answer:

C. The water molecules in ice are farther apart than those in liquid water, so the ice floats, maintaining the warmer, denser water at the lake bottom.
